Technical Specifications
The following tables highlight the features and specifications for the Brocade G620 Switch.
System Specifications
System Component Description
Enclosure 1U, port-side back-to-front exhaust airflow, power from the back.
Power inlet C14 (AC power supply), Phoenix Contact 1804917 (DC power supply) accepts 10-14AWG/size per
local electrical code.
Power supplies Dual, hot-swappable, AC, or DC input power supplies with integrated system cooling fans.
Fans Three fans are integrated into each power-supply and fan assembly.
Cooling Port side to the nonport side of the switch (nonport-side exhaust) and nonport side to the port side
(port-side exhaust).
System architecture Nonblocking shared memory switch.
Port-to-port latency Less than 900 nanoseconds (including FEC) with no contention (destination port is free).
Fibre Channel Ports
System Component Description
Fibre Channel ports 48 SFP+ ports that support any combination of short wavelength (SWL) and long wavelength (LWL)
or extended long wavelength (ELWL) optical media.
4 QSFP ports that support 16G and 32G QSFP transceivers.
The SFP+ ports are capable of auto-negotiating to 4, 8, 16, or 32G speeds depending on the SFP+
model and the minimum supported speed of the optical transceiver at the other end of the link.
4G, 8G, and 16G performance is enabled by 16G SFP+ transceivers if the other end of the
connection has a minimum speed of 4G.
8G, 16G, and 32G performance is enabled by 32G SFP+ transceivers if the other end of the
connection has a minimum speed of 8G.
2G, 4G, and 8G transceivers are not supported.
ANSI Fibre Channel protocol FC-PH (Fibre Channel Physical and Signaling Interface standard).
Modes of operation Fibre Channel Class 2 and Class 3.
Fabric initialization Complies with FC-SW-3 Rev. 6.6.
Fibre Channel over IP (FCIP) Complies with FC-IP 2.3 of the FCA profile.
Port status Bicolor LED (amber/green).
Other Ports
System Component Description
Serial console port One three-wire (Tx, Rx, Gnd) UART serial port
Ethernet management port One 1000/100/10Mb/s Ethernet port
USB port One external USB port
